Continuing our series of video interviews with the 2013 jury members provided by organisers of the D&AD Awards, this video sees Prakash talking about three trends she saw in the Mobile Marketing category.
She also talks about how discussions took place between jury members to decide which entries would be taken into consideration as the topic 'Mobile Marketing' could be a broad one.
